Before you start cooking, inspect the quality of the Charcoal you're using. Charcoal lumps or in briquettes should produce little ash. Charcoal that produces excessive ash reduces airflow and may contain fillers. You should consider the amount of time you cook with it, as well as whether you want it to taste cleaner or more smokey. Cut the zucchini and eggplants into 2 cm-thick circles to prepare the marinade. Slice peppers. Place them on a rack and marinate them in honey-soy. As an appetizer, you can also serve charcoal vegetable as a main dish. Once they're ready, spread them on a plate decorated with lettuce leaves.
